The Venus Cycle: A Quick Overview

Venus takes about 18 months to complete its cycle in relation to Earth and the Sun. This cycle includes key phases that reflect shifting energies in our emotional and relational lives:

1 Venus Direct

A time of clarity, attraction, and harmony in relationships. We feel more open to expressing affection and building connections.

2 Venus Retrograde

Occurs approximately every 18 months for about 40 days. This is a period of reflection, reevaluation, and sometimes resurfacing of past relationships or unresolved emotions.

3 Venus Cazimi (Conjunction with the Sun)

Known as the “rebirth” of Venus, this marks a powerful time for setting new intentions in love and relationships.

4 Venus Morning Star & Evening Star

Depending on its position, Venus as a Morning Star encourages new beginnings, while Venus as an Evening Star fosters deeper connection and harmony.

By tracking these phases, individuals can better align their emotional responses and relationship decisions with cosmic energy.
